Required information Exercise 6-4A Calculate inventory amounts when costs are rising (L06-3) (The following information applies to the questions displayed below.) During the year, TRC Corporation has the following inventory transactions. Date Transaction Jan. 1 Beginning inventory Apr. 7 Purchase Jul.16 Purchase Oct. 6 Purchase Number of Units 52 132 202 112 498 Unit Cost $ 44 46 49 50 Total Cost $ 2,288 6,072 9,898 5,600 $23,858 For the entire year, the company sells 432 units of inventory for $62 each. Exercise 6-4A Part 2 2. Using LIFO, calculate ending Inventory, cost of goods sold, sales revenue, and gross profit.
